programming

Navigating the Digital Landscape

Navigating the vast landscape of the World Wide Web involves a multifaceted approach encompassing information retrieval, online communication, and cybersecurity awareness. The burgeoning expanse of the internet, often referred to as the digital realm, necessitates a nuanced understanding of its various facets to optimize the user experience and ensure digital well-being.

To commence this digital odyssey, users typically employ web browsers, software applications designed for retrieving, presenting, and traversing information resources on the internet. Prominent examples include Google Chrome, Mozilla Firefox, and Microsoft Edge. Within these browsers, users enter Uniform Resource Locators (URLs) to access specific websites, leveraging the hypertext transfer protocol (HTTP) or its secure variant, HTTPS.

As users traverse the virtual landscape, search engines play a pivotal role in information discovery. Search engines, such as Google, Bing, and Yahoo, employ complex algorithms to index and rank web pages based on relevance to user queries. Employing succinct and precise search queries enhances the efficiency of information retrieval.

Web pages, the fundamental building blocks of the internet, are often structured using HyperText Markup Language (HTML), Cascading Style Sheets (CSS), and JavaScript. HTML provides the structural framework, CSS contributes to the visual presentation, and JavaScript enables dynamic interactivity. Understanding these technologies empowers users to comprehend the composition of web content and, in some cases, modify or customize it.

Social media platforms, an integral component of the contemporary web, facilitate online interaction, content sharing, and community building. Platforms like Facebook, Twitter, and Instagram connect individuals across geographical boundaries, fostering a digital agora for the exchange of ideas, information, and multimedia content. Mindful engagement on social media involves considerations of privacy settings, responsible sharing, and critical evaluation of the information encountered.

E-commerce, another significant facet of the web, enables online transactions for goods and services. Platforms like Amazon, eBay, and Alibaba revolutionize commerce by providing a global marketplace accessible from the comfort of one’s digital device. Users engaging in online shopping should prioritize secure payment methods, verify the authenticity of sellers, and be vigilant against phishing attempts.

As users traverse the web, cybersecurity assumes paramount importance. The digital landscape is rife with potential threats, including malware, phishing, and data breaches. Implementing robust cybersecurity practices involves employing reputable antivirus software, using strong, unique passwords, and exercising caution when clicking on links or downloading files. Regular software updates, including security patches, further fortify the digital fortress against evolving threats.

In the realm of online communication, electronic mail (email) remains a ubiquitous tool. Users exchange messages and files, both personal and professional, via email platforms such as Gmail, Outlook, and Yahoo Mail. Responsible email practices encompass vigilant scrutiny of incoming messages for potential phishing attempts, judicious use of carbon copy (CC) and blind carbon copy (BCC), and safeguarding sensitive information through encryption when necessary.

Blogging and content creation platforms, exemplified by WordPress, Medium, and Blogger, empower individuals and organizations to disseminate information and perspectives. Understanding the nuances of content creation, including copyright considerations and ethical sourcing, contributes to the responsible dissemination of information on the web.

The web, however, is not without its challenges. The proliferation of misinformation and disinformation, often exacerbated by the rapid dissemination afforded by social media, underscores the need for digital literacy. Users should cultivate a discerning eye, critically evaluating the credibility of sources and corroborating information before accepting it as veracious.

Furthermore, the advent of Web 2.0 ushered in a paradigm shift towards user-generated content and interactivity. Wikis, exemplified by Wikipedia, epitomize collaborative knowledge creation, allowing users worldwide to contribute, edit, and refine information. Engaging with wikis involves adherence to community guidelines, citation of reputable sources, and fostering a spirit of collaboration.

In the educational realm, Massive Open Online Courses (MOOCs) have democratized access to knowledge, enabling learners to engage with diverse subjects and disciplines. Platforms like Coursera, edX, and Khan Academy provide a virtual classroom experience, transcending geographical barriers and catering to a global audience.

The evolution of the web is inexorably tied to advancements in technology. The advent of Web 3.0, often conceptualized as the semantic web, envisions a more intelligent and interconnected digital landscape. Artificial intelligence, blockchain, and the Internet of Things (IoT) are poised to shape the future of the web, imbuing it with heightened interactivity, decentralized structures, and enhanced security.

In conclusion, the multifaceted nature of the World Wide Web demands a comprehensive approach to navigate its realms effectively. From the basics of web browsing and search engine utilization to the complexities of cybersecurity, social media engagement, and content creation, users stand to benefit from an informed and discerning interaction with the digital domain. As technology continues to advance, a commitment to digital literacy and responsible online citizenship becomes imperative, ensuring that users not only consume information but actively contribute to the dynamic tapestry of the web.

More Informations

Delving deeper into the intricacies of web interaction, one must explore the evolving landscape of web technologies, emerging trends, and the ethical considerations that underpin the digital experience. As technology continues its relentless march forward, it brings forth innovations that shape the very fabric of the internet, transforming how individuals, businesses, and societies engage with the digital realm.

The backbone of the web, the Domain Name System (DNS), serves as a crucial component in translating human-readable domain names into IP addresses, facilitating the seamless connection between users and web servers. Understanding the DNS system contributes to troubleshooting connectivity issues and comprehending the hierarchical structure that governs the internet’s addressing system.

Web development, a dynamic field at the intersection of design and functionality, encompasses a plethora of technologies and frameworks. Cascading Style Sheets (CSS) frameworks like Bootstrap and JavaScript libraries such as jQuery streamline the process of creating visually appealing and interactive web pages. Mastery of these tools empowers web developers to craft immersive and responsive user experiences.

Moreover, the advent of Application Programming Interfaces (APIs) has revolutionized how different web services interact and share data. RESTful APIs, in particular, have become ubiquitous, facilitating the seamless integration of disparate systems and enabling the development of robust, interconnected web applications.

The emergence of Progressive Web Apps (PWAs) represents a paradigm shift in web development, blending the best of web and mobile applications. PWAs offer offline functionality, push notifications, and a responsive design, providing users with an app-like experience directly through their web browsers. This innovation caters to the growing demand for fast, reliable, and engaging web experiences.

The significance of User Experience (UX) and User Interface (UI) design cannot be overstated in the contemporary web landscape. Intuitive and aesthetically pleasing interfaces enhance user engagement and satisfaction. Design thinking principles, usability testing, and accessibility considerations play pivotal roles in creating inclusive and user-friendly digital spaces.

Web accessibility, a critical aspect often overlooked, ensures that digital content is perceivable, operable, and understandable for individuals with disabilities. Adhering to Web Content Accessibility Guidelines (WCAG) guarantees that websites and applications are inclusive, catering to diverse user needs and preferences.

On the horizon of web technologies, the rise of WebAssembly opens new frontiers in high-performance web applications. WebAssembly allows developers to execute code written in languages like C++ and Rust directly in the browser, unlocking unprecedented computational capabilities and expanding the scope of what can be achieved within the confines of a web page.

The ethical dimensions of web usage warrant meticulous consideration in an era where data privacy and digital rights are at the forefront of societal discourse. Surveillance capitalism, the commodification of personal data for profit, underscores the importance of user awareness and advocacy for transparent data practices. Implementing privacy-enhancing technologies, such as virtual private networks (VPNs) and encrypted communication channels, safeguards user data from unwarranted surveillance.

Digital citizenship, encompassing responsible online behavior and ethical use of technology, assumes paramount importance. Combatting cyberbullying, respecting intellectual property rights, and fostering a culture of online civility are integral to the ethical fabric of the internet. The realization that online actions have tangible consequences underscores the need for a collective commitment to digital ethics.

As artificial intelligence (AI) continues to permeate digital spaces, ethical considerations in AI development become increasingly crucial. Bias in algorithms, transparency in decision-making processes, and the ethical use of AI in areas like facial recognition demand careful scrutiny. Striking a balance between technological advancement and ethical responsibility ensures that AI serves as a force for positive transformation.

Blockchain technology, originally devised for secure and transparent financial transactions through cryptocurrencies like Bitcoin, has broader implications for web development. Decentralized applications (DApps) leverage blockchain’s distributed ledger to create tamper-resistant and censorship-resistant platforms. The potential disruption of centralized models in domains such as finance, governance, and content distribution underscores the transformative power of blockchain in reshaping the web.

In conclusion, the depth of web interaction extends beyond the surface-level mechanics of browsing and searching. It encompasses the underlying technologies that drive the web, the ethical considerations that govern digital citizenship, and the transformative trends that shape its future. As users traverse the ever-evolving digital landscape, a holistic understanding of web technologies, coupled with a commitment to ethical digital practices, positions individuals to navigate the complexities of the web with discernment and responsibility.

Keywords

  1. Domain Name System (DNS): The DNS is a hierarchical system that translates human-readable domain names into IP addresses, facilitating the communication between users and web servers. It serves as the backbone of the internet, enabling users to access websites using familiar domain names.

  2. Web Development: This encompasses the process of creating websites or web applications. It involves various technologies, including HTML, CSS, and JavaScript, along with frameworks like Bootstrap and libraries like jQuery. Web developers use these tools to design visually appealing and functional web pages.

  3. Application Programming Interfaces (APIs): APIs enable different software applications to communicate and share data. RESTful APIs, in particular, facilitate the integration of diverse systems, allowing for the development of interconnected web applications.

  4. Progressive Web Apps (PWAs): PWAs represent a new approach to web development, combining the advantages of web and mobile applications. They offer features like offline functionality, push notifications, and a responsive design, providing users with an app-like experience directly through web browsers.

  5. User Experience (UX) and User Interface (UI) Design: UX and UI design focus on creating intuitive and visually appealing digital interfaces. Design thinking principles, usability testing, and accessibility considerations are crucial for crafting inclusive and user-friendly web experiences.

  6. Web Accessibility: This refers to the design and development practices that ensure digital content is accessible to individuals with disabilities. Adhering to Web Content Accessibility Guidelines (WCAG) ensures that websites are inclusive and can be navigated by a diverse range of users.

  7. WebAssembly: WebAssembly is a binary instruction format that enables high-performance execution of code in web browsers. It allows developers to use languages like C++ and Rust to achieve computational capabilities beyond traditional web languages like JavaScript.

  8. Data Privacy: With the increasing concerns around data privacy, this term involves protecting individuals’ personal information from unauthorized access or use. Privacy-enhancing technologies like virtual private networks (VPNs) and encrypted communication channels contribute to safeguarding user data.

  9. Digital Citizenship: This encompasses responsible online behavior, ethical use of technology, and participation in online communities. It involves considerations such as combating cyberbullying, respecting intellectual property rights, and fostering a culture of online civility.

  10. Artificial Intelligence (AI): AI involves the development of systems that can perform tasks that typically require human intelligence. Ethical considerations in AI development include addressing bias in algorithms, ensuring transparency, and using AI responsibly in areas like facial recognition.

  11. Blockchain Technology: Originally associated with cryptocurrencies, blockchain is a decentralized and tamper-resistant ledger technology. Its potential applications extend to decentralized applications (DApps) that leverage blockchain’s transparency and security in various domains like finance, governance, and content distribution.

In interpreting these key terms, it’s evident that the web ecosystem is multifaceted, involving both technical aspects like development frameworks and protocols (DNS, APIs, WebAssembly) and broader considerations like user experience, accessibility, and ethical dimensions. The continuous evolution of technology, particularly with trends like AI and blockchain, underscores the need for users to navigate the digital landscape with awareness, responsibility, and a holistic understanding of these key concepts.

Back to top button